    Americano vs Cappuccino: What’s the Difference?

    The distinct differences between an Americano and a cappuccino are that an Americano is made with espresso and hot water whereas a cappuccino is made with equal parts espresso, steamed milk, and milk foam. 

    What is an Americano?

    An Americano is a single shot of espresso topped with hot water.

    The history of the Americano

    To learn the history of the Americano drink, we'll have to go all the way back to World War II. The United States had to ship tons of American coffee over to troops in Europe, but often times that wasn't enough for them. So, American soldiers took to going to local coffee shops, particularly in Italy, and they didn't like the taste of the straight espresso. To make it. more palatable, they added hot water to their espresso to dilute the bitter taste, and thus the Americano coffee was born. 

    What is the difference between regular coffee and Americano?

    An Americano is the combination of hot water and espresso whereas regular coffee is simply just brewed coffee. 

    What is an Americano with milk called?

    Don't like black coffee? Me either. If you want an Americano with milk, you can order or make an Americano with milk or a White Americano. 

    What is a cappuccino?

    A cappuccino is 1-2 shots of espresso, steamed milk, and a layer of foamed milk on top.

    Is a cappuccino stronger than coffee? 

    Nope! It has roughly the same amount of caffeine, but because it is made with espresso shots, the main difference is the taste. Cappuccinos will taste stronger than drip coffee or brewed coffee. 

    Wet cappuccino vs dry cappuccino

    A wet cappuccino has more steamed milk and less foam. A dry cappuccino is less steamed milk and more foam. A super wet cappuccino is a latte and a bone dry cappuccino is just a foam pillow and espresso, so essentially a macchiato. 

    Other espresso drinks, what's the difference between them all?

    Aside from an Americano and cappuccino, there are a handful of other espresso-based drinks. A lot of the key differences between these popular drinks is the ratio of what you put on top of the espresso. Here's the full breakdown of different types of coffee drinks. 

    Lattes. Unlike the traditional cappuccino, lattes double the steamed milk and forgo the foam on top. Lattes will typically have a sweet taste due to the different flavors added in like hazelnut or vanilla. 

    Mocha. Mocha is a cappuccino but with the addition of chocolate. 

    Latte Macchiato. A latte macchiato is equal parts espresso and milk foam.

    Flat White. A flat white is a combination of steamed milk and espresso. 

    Cafe au Lait. This is coffee with hot milk added. White coffee is coffee with cold milk added.

    All about espresso

    To get the perfect cappuccino, Americano, latte, or whatever type of espresso drink you prefer, you need to start with a strong foundation which means properly brewing yourself a shot, or two, of espresso. There aren't espresso coffee beans. Espresso is made or can be made, with the same coffee beans that make regular drip coffee. However what makes espresso "espresso" is the brewing method. 

    Drip coffee is made by pouring hot water over loosely packed coffee grounds and letting that slowly work its way through the grounds and thus your cup of coffee is created. Espresso is made by forcing almost boiling water through finely-ground coffee beans at high pressure. 

    ​To really get that rich flavor, you want to use dark roast coffee for making espresso. Not only will it give you that strong coffee taste, but it also gives you that beautiful caramel-colored foam on top. You can always make espresso with whatever roast you prefer, but that's what the coffee experts recommend.

    What is the difference between an Americano, cappuccino, and latte?

    ​Americano vs. Cappuccino vs. Latte, the only difference here is truly personal preference. These are all very popular coffee drinks and it just depends on how you like your cup of coffee!

    Americano. Espresso + Hot Water. This is a similar drink to black coffee. If you prefer your coffee with no milk, give an Americano a try!

    Cappuccino. Espresso + Steamed Milk + Foam. 

    Latte.​ Espresso + Double Steamed Milk + Dash of Foam

    Americano vs Cappuccino: get to know all the differences

    Let's break down the similarities and differences between Americano vs cappuccino for all you coffee lovers out there. 

    Taste.​ Because an Americano is basically black coffee, it will be a bit more bitter and a cappuccino will be creamier and sweeter. 

    Espresso.​ Both of these drinks typically call for a double shot of espresso. You can get a single-shot cappuccino, but most are made with 2 shots of espresso. 

    Milk vs. Water. This is the biggest difference. Americanos have a 1:1 ratio of espresso to water with no milk. You can absolutely add hot milk for a creamier taste, but if you order an Americano you will not get any milk in there. Cappuccinos have espresso, steamed milk, and a top of foamed milk. There is no hot water in this coffee beverage, but the milk adds a creamy texture. When ordering this at a coffee shop, you can request any type of milk you prefer. 

    Caffeine.​ Because they are made with the same amount of espresso, the caffeine content is the same. 

    Calories.​ I am not a calorie counter, but I know some people like to be conscious of that! Because an Americano is just water and espresso, there are basically no calories. A cappuccino's calories depend on the milk you use. For example, if you use whole milk, there's about 75 calories. 

    Americano vs Cappuccino: What’s the Difference?

    Is americano or cappuccino stronger?

    Since they both have or can have, the same amount of espresso, they are equal in terms of caffeine content. 1 oz. of espresso has about 64 mg of caffeine. If you're looking for high caffeine content, I recommend a double espresso. If you're looking for less caffeine, 1 shot of espresso should do. For reference, 2 ounces of espresso can range from 60-100 milligrams of caffeine whereas a 12-ounce drip coffee can range from 95-180 milligrams of caffeine. 

    Talking taste, however, the strength of an Americano vs. cappuccino heavily relies on the amount of milk or water in it. If you want less milk or water, you'll of course have a really rich taste. If you like the taste of coffee, you'll love a good, strong espresso drink. 

    Which has more milk americano or cappuccino?

    A cappuccino. An Americano has no milk. A cappuccino is espresso, steamed milk, and a layer of milk foam. 

    Which is better an Americano or a cappuccino?

    Different drinks for different tastes! I personally like my coffee with milk or creamer, so I would order a cappuccino at my local coffee shop. However, both are a great option, especially if you like the strong taste of coffee.

    FAQ

    Which has more caffeine americano or cappuccino?

    They both have roughly the same amount of caffeine depending on the amount of espresso you put in. 

    How is an Americano different from regular coffee?

    An Americano is an espresso (finely-ground, tightly packed coffee grounds with boiling water being pressed through at high pressure) + hot water, whereas regular coffee is slowly brewed with hot water and loosely packed coffee grounds. 

    Is it normal to get an Americano with milk?

    ​It's not traditionally made that way, but you can certainly ask for milk.
